Within the context of a distribution center, various roles contribute to the overall functionality. Warehouse associates perform tasks such as receiving, sorting, and stocking merchandise, ensuring accurate inventory management. Forklift operators facilitate the movement of goods within the warehouse, optimizing storage and retrieval processes. Logistics analysts utilize data analysis to improve efficiency and minimize operational costs. Each role plays a crucial part in the seamless flow of goods through the distribution center, contributing to the larger goal of meeting consumer demand. The interconnectedness of these roles highlights the complex nature of distribution center operations. A breakdown in one area can impact the entire process, underscoring the importance of each individual contribution.

Frequently Asked Questions

This section addresses common inquiries regarding employment searches focused on Target distribution centers using the Indeed platform.

Question 1: What types of jobs are typically available at Target distribution centers?

Positions commonly found at Target distribution centers include warehouse associate, forklift operator, inventory specialist, logistics analyst, operations manager, and maintenance technician. Specific roles and availability vary based on location and operational needs.

Question 2: How can Indeed be used effectively to find distribution center jobs at Target?

Effective use of Indeed involves utilizing precise keywords such as “Target distribution center,” specifying the desired location, and filtering by job type (e.g., full-time, part-time). Activating job alerts for relevant postings ensures timely notification of new opportunities.

Question 3: What are the typical work schedules and shift patterns at Target distribution centers?

Distribution centers frequently operate on a 24/7 basis, often involving shift work, including evenings, weekends, and overnight shifts. Specific schedules vary by location and operational demands. Shift preferences should be clarified during the application process.

Question 4: What are the physical demands associated with distribution center work?

Many distribution center roles involve physical activity, including lifting, carrying, and moving merchandise. Job descriptions typically outline specific physical requirements. Applicants should assess their physical capabilities against these requirements.

Question 5: What are the potential career advancement opportunities within Target’s distribution network?

Target frequently provides career development programs and internal promotion opportunities. Opportunities for advancement vary by location and performance. Inquiries about career progression can be made during the interview process.

Question 6: How competitive is the hiring process for Target distribution center positions?

The competitiveness of the hiring process varies based on factors such as location, job type, and current labor market conditions. Submitting a complete and accurate application, highlighting relevant skills and experience, increases the likelihood of securing an interview.

Tips for Utilizing “Indeed Target Distribution Center” in a Job Search

These tips offer practical guidance for maximizing the effectiveness of “Indeed Target Distribution Center” as a keyword search strategy. Careful attention to these recommendations can significantly improve search results and increase the likelihood of securing desired employment.

Tip 1: Refine Search Terms with Specific Roles: Avoid generic searches. Instead, combine “Target Distribution Center” with specific job titles such as “Forklift Operator,” “Inventory Specialist,” or “Warehouse Associate” to target desired roles accurately. For example, searching “Target Distribution Center Inventory Specialist” yields results specifically for inventory-related positions within Target’s distribution network.

Tip 2: Utilize Location Filters Effectively: Specify the desired geographical area by city, state, or zip code to narrow down results to relevant locations. This prevents irrelevant listings from distant areas from cluttering search results. Limiting the search to a specific city ensures focus on opportunities within a reasonable commute.

Tip 3: Leverage Advanced Search Options: Explore Indeed’s advanced search filters, including experience level, salary range, and job type (full-time, part-time, contract) to refine results further. Specifying “entry-level” targets positions suitable for those starting their careers, while “full-time” filters out part-time or temporary roles.

Tip 4: Set Up Job Alerts for Timely Notifications: Create job alerts for “Target Distribution Center” combined with desired job titles and locations. This ensures immediate notification of new postings, providing a competitive edge. Timely application submission significantly increases chances of consideration.

Tip 5: Regularly Review and Update Search Criteria: Periodically review and adjust search terms and filters to reflect evolving job market trends and personal career goals. Adapting to changing market dynamics maintains search relevance and maximizes effectiveness.

Tip 6: Research Target’s Distribution Network: Understanding Target’s logistics network and the specific functions of different distribution centers provides valuable context for tailoring job searches. Researching locations and operational specializations can inform location preferences and job title selections.

Tip 7: Thoroughly Review Job Descriptions: Carefully examine job descriptions, paying attention to required skills, experience, and physical demands. Ensuring alignment between personal capabilities and job requirements increases the likelihood of a successful application and long-term job satisfaction.
